通过与 Jira 对比,让您更全面了解 PingCode

  • 首页
  • 需求与产品管理
  • 项目管理
  • 测试与缺陷管理
  • 知识管理
  • 效能度量
        • 更多产品

          客户为中心的产品管理工具

          专业的软件研发项目管理工具

          简单易用的团队知识库管理

          可量化的研发效能度量工具

          测试用例维护与计划执行

          以团队为中心的协作沟通

          研发工作流自动化工具

          账号认证与安全管理工具

          Why PingCode
          为什么选择 PingCode ?

          6000+企业信赖之选,为研发团队降本增效

        • 行业解决方案
          先进制造(即将上线)
        • 解决方案1
        • 解决方案2
  • Jira替代方案

25人以下免费

目录

网站开发语言怎么查

网站开发语言怎么查

网站开发语言怎么查

查找网站开发语言的方式有很多种,主要包括:查看网站的源代码、使用浏览器开发者工具、使用在线工具和插件、查看网站的技术栈、与网站开发者交流等方法。查看网站的源代码、使用浏览器开发者工具、使用在线工具和插件是最常用的方式。接下来,我们将详细描述如何使用浏览器开发者工具来查找网站的开发语言。

使用浏览器开发者工具是一种便捷且深入的方法。通过按下F12键或右键单击页面并选择“检查”,可以打开开发者工具。在开发者工具中,你可以查看HTML、CSS、JavaScript等前端语言的使用情况。通过查看Network选项卡,可以观察到服务器发送的响应头信息,从中可以获取后端开发语言的线索。


一、查看网站的源代码

查看网站的源代码是了解其前端开发语言的最基础方法。大多数现代浏览器都提供查看源代码的功能。

1.1 右键查看源代码

在任何网页上,右键点击并选择“查看页面源代码”或类似的选项。这将打开一个新的窗口或标签页,显示该页面的HTML、CSS和JavaScript代码。

1.2 了解HTML、CSS和JavaScript

通过查看源代码,你可以轻松地识别出HTML、CSS和JavaScript代码。这些是网页前端最常见的三种语言。HTML用于标记内容,CSS用于样式设计,而JavaScript则用于网页的动态功能。

二、使用浏览器开发者工具

浏览器开发者工具不仅能查看源代码,还能提供更多关于网站运行时的信息。

2.1 启用开发者工具

在大多数浏览器中,可以通过按下F12键或右键单击页面并选择“检查”来启用开发者工具。开发者工具通常分为多个选项卡,包括Elements、Console、Network等。

2.2 Elements选项卡

在Elements选项卡中,你可以查看网页的DOM结构和样式信息。这可以帮助你了解网站使用了哪些HTML和CSS。

2.3 Console选项卡

Console选项卡显示JavaScript的日志信息和错误消息。通过查看Console,你可以了解网站使用了哪些JavaScript库或框架。

2.4 Network选项卡

在Network选项卡中,你可以查看所有网络请求及其响应信息。通过查看响应头信息,可以获取服务器端技术的一些线索,例如PHP、ASP.NET等。

三、使用在线工具和插件

除了手动查看源代码和使用开发者工具,许多在线工具和浏览器插件可以帮助你快速识别网站的开发语言。

3.1 BuiltWith

BuiltWith是一个强大的在线工具,可以分析网站的技术栈。只需输入网站的URL,BuiltWith就会生成一个详细的报告,列出该网站使用的各种技术,包括前端和后端语言、框架、CDN等。

3.2 Wappalyzer

Wappalyzer是一款流行的浏览器插件,支持Chrome和Firefox。安装Wappalyzer插件后,只需点击插件图标,即可查看当前网站使用的技术栈,包括前端和后端语言、框架、分析工具等。

四、查看网站的技术栈

有些网站会公开其技术栈信息,特别是一些技术博客或公司网站。

4.1 查阅About页面或技术博客

一些网站会在About页面或技术博客中详细介绍其使用的技术栈。这些信息通常包括前端和后端语言、框架、数据库、第三方服务等。

4.2 开源项目

如果你在查看一个开源项目的网站,可以查阅其GitHub仓库或其他代码托管平台上的README文件或文档,了解其技术栈。

五、与网站开发者交流

如果你对某个网站的开发语言有特殊兴趣,可以尝试与网站的开发者交流。

5.1 联系方式

大多数网站都会提供联系方式,如联系表单、电子邮件地址或社交媒体链接。你可以通过这些方式联系网站的开发者,询问其使用的开发语言和技术栈。

5.2 技术社区

在技术社区或论坛上,如Stack Overflow、Reddit等,你也可以找到相关的信息或直接向社区成员提问。

六、进一步了解开发语言

查找到网站的开发语言后,可以进一步学习这些语言,了解其特点和应用场景。

6.1 学习资源

互联网提供了丰富的学习资源,包括在线教程、文档、视频课程等。选择适合你的学习资源,深入了解所感兴趣的开发语言。

6.2 实践项目

通过实际项目练习,可以更好地掌握一门开发语言。选择一些开源项目或自己动手开发一个小项目,实践所学的知识。

七、常见网站开发语言

了解一些常见的网站开发语言及其特点,有助于更快地识别和理解网站的技术栈。

7.1 HTML、CSS、JavaScript

这三种语言是网页前端开发的基础。HTML用于标记内容,CSS用于样式设计,JavaScript则用于动态功能。

7.2 PHP

PHP是一种流行的服务器端脚本语言,广泛用于网站开发,特别是内容管理系统如WordPress。

7.3 Python

Python是一种通用的编程语言,也常用于网站开发。Django和Flask是两个流行的Python web框架。

7.4 Ruby

Ruby是一种动态编程语言,常用于网站开发。Ruby on RAIls是一个流行的web框架,简化了许多常见的开发任务。

7.5 Java

Java是一种广泛使用的编程语言,也常用于企业级网站开发。Spring是一个流行的Java web框架。

7.6 JavaScript(Node.js)

除了前端开发,JavaScript也可以用于服务器端开发。Node.js是一个基于JavaScript的服务器端运行环境,广泛用于现代web应用开发。

八、网站开发语言的选择

选择合适的开发语言取决于多个因素,包括项目需求、开发团队的技能和经验、现有技术栈等。

8.1 项目需求

不同的项目可能需要不同的开发语言。例如,电子商务网站可能需要一个强大的内容管理系统,而一个简单的博客可能只需要基本的HTML、CSS和JavaScript。

8.2 开发团队的技能和经验

选择开发团队熟悉的语言和技术,可以提高开发效率和代码质量。如果团队成员擅长Python和Django,那么选择这些技术可能是一个明智的选择。

8.3 现有技术栈

如果你的项目需要与现有系统集成,选择与现有技术栈兼容的语言和框架可以减少开发成本和复杂性。

九、总结

查找网站开发语言的方法有很多,包括查看源代码、使用开发者工具、在线工具和插件、查看技术栈和与开发者交流。每种方法都有其优点和适用场景,选择合适的方法可以帮助你更有效地了解网站的开发语言。进一步了解这些语言及其应用场景,有助于你在网站开发领域取得更大的成功。

相关问答FAQs:

1. 如何确定一个网站使用的开发语言?
要确定一个网站使用的开发语言,可以通过以下几种方法来查找:

  • 查看网站源代码:在浏览器中右键点击网页,选择“查看页面源代码”,然后搜索关键词,如“”、“”等,根据代码结构和语法特征判断开发语言。

  • 使用在线工具:有一些在线工具可以帮助你分析网站的开发语言,只需要输入网站的URL,工具会自动检测并显示使用的开发语言。

  • 查看HTTP响应头信息:使用开发者工具或浏览器插件,查看网站的HTTP响应头信息,其中可能包含有关使用的开发语言的信息。

  • 使用Whois查询:通过Whois查询网站的注册信息,有时可以找到网站的开发者或开发公司的联系信息,从而了解使用的开发语言。

2. 网站开发语言有哪些常见的选择?
在网站开发中,常见的开发语言包括但不限于以下几种:

  • HTML/CSS:用于网页的结构和样式定义。
  • JavaScript:用于实现网页的交互和动态效果。
  • PHP:用于服务器端的网站开发和后台处理。
  • Python:用于开发动态网站和Web应用程序。
  • Ruby:用于开发Web应用程序和快速原型。
  • Java:用于开发大型企业级网站和应用程序。
  • C#:用于开发Microsoft平台上的Web应用程序。
  • ASP.NET:用于开发基于Microsoft.NET的Web应用程序。

3. 如何选择适合自己的网站开发语言?
选择适合自己的网站开发语言需要考虑以下几个因素:

  • 目标和需求:根据你想要实现的功能和网站的需求,选择能够满足需求的开发语言。不同的开发语言在不同方面有各自的优势和特点。

  • 学习曲线:考虑自己的编程经验和学习能力,选择一个学习曲线相对较低的开发语言,以便更容易上手和开发。

  • 生态系统和支持:查看开发语言的生态系统和社区支持情况,包括文档、教程、开发工具等,以便能够获得更好的开发体验和技术支持。

  • 团队和合作:如果你是在团队中开发网站,需要考虑团队成员的技术能力和经验,以及团队已有的技术栈,选择能够与团队协作和整合的开发语言。

相关文章